As 3D printing technology advances, especially with large-scale printers expected to become more prevalent by 2026, understanding safety features is crucial for users and operators. Large 3D printers pose unique risks due to their size, power, and the materials used. This article highlights the essential safety features you should look for in a 2026 large 3D printer.
Important Safety Features of 2026 Large 3D Printers
- Enclosed Printing Chambers: Enclosures prevent accidental contact with hot components and contain fumes or debris.
- Automatic Fire Suppression Systems: Integrated fire extinguishing systems activate in case of overheating or fire hazards.
- Emergency Stop Buttons: Easily accessible emergency stop mechanisms allow immediate shutdown during emergencies.
- Interlock Safety Doors: Doors that automatically shut or disable the printer when opened to prevent injury.
- Temperature Monitoring and Control: Advanced sensors ensure the extruder and heated bed operate within safe temperature ranges.
- Filament and Material Safety Features: Detection systems alert users to incompatible or unsafe materials.
- Ventilation and Filtration Systems: HEPA filters and exhaust systems reduce harmful fumes and particles.
- Automated Bed Leveling and Calibration: Reduces manual intervention, minimizing risk of burns or injury.
- Remote Monitoring Capabilities: Allows operators to oversee printing sessions remotely, reducing exposure to hazards.
- Built-in Error Detection and Alerts: Notifies users of malfunctions or safety issues promptly.
Additional Safety Tips for 3D Printing with Large Printers
While safety features enhance protection, users should also follow best practices to ensure safe operation of large 3D printers:
- Always wear appropriate personal protective equipment, such as gloves and safety glasses.
- Ensure the workspace is well-ventilated to disperse fumes.
- Regularly inspect safety features and maintenance protocols.
- Keep a fire extinguisher nearby and ensure all users are trained in its use.
- Avoid leaving printers unattended during operation, especially during initial startup or shutdown.
- Use only recommended materials compatible with your printer model.
- Follow manufacturer guidelines for setup, operation, and maintenance.
